  8. Depending upon what’s available in your area, or where you’ll be sending them, you could start with a cag one profile. It will simply add a flat area for stability as you adjust. Something like a 25/40 might give you stability as well as feeling more like your larger blades. I’ve personally felt Quads and the like are too involved for your average adult skater, but perhaps a 7-10 or 9.5-10.5 would suit you well.
